Course structure

• Introduction to IoT Architecture
• Advanced IoT Technologies and Protocols
• IoT Security and Privacy
• Cloud Computing for IoT
• Data Analytics and Machine Learning in IoT
• IoT Integration and Interoperability
• IoT Project Management
• IoT Scalability and Reliability
• IoT Edge Computing
• IoT Industry Trends and Case Studies
